How to Reach Bellmead, United States

To reach Bellmead in the United States, you can follow these steps:

  1. By Air:
  2. The nearest major airport to Bellmead is the Waco Regional Airport (ACT), located approximately 10 miles away. You can book a flight to this airport from various domestic destinations.

  3. By Road:
  4. If you prefer traveling by road, you can reach Bellmead via the following routes:

    • From Dallas: Take I-35E South and continue for about 100 miles until you reach Bellmead.
    • From Austin: Take I-35 North and continue for approximately 100 miles until you reach Bellmead.
    • From Houston: Take I-45 North and then merge onto TX-6 North. Continue on TX-6 North for about 160 miles until you reach Bellmead.
  5. By Train:
  6. Unfortunately, Bellmead does not have a direct train station. However, you can consider taking a train to Waco, which is the nearest city with a train station. From there, you can take a taxi or use other transportation options to reach Bellmead, which is approximately 5 miles away.

Getting to know Bellmead

Bellmead is a city located in McLennan County, Texas, United States. Situated just north of Waco, Bellmead is a vibrant community with a rich history and diverse population. The city offers a range of amenities and attractions, making it an attractive place to live, work, and visit.

One of the notable features of Bellmead is its convenient location. Being in close proximity to Waco, residents have easy access to a wide range of shopping, dining, and entertainment options. Additionally, the city is well-connected to major highways, allowing for convenient travel to other parts of Texas.

Bellmead is also known for its strong sense of community. The city hosts various events and festivals throughout the year, bringing residents together and fostering a sense of unity. The friendly atmosphere and welcoming nature of the community make it an ideal place for families and individuals looking for a close-knit neighborhood.

Furthermore, Bellmead boasts several parks and recreational areas, providing ample opportunities for outdoor activities. Whether it is hiking, picnicking, or playing sports, residents can enjoy the beauty of nature right on their doorstep. The city's commitment to maintaining green spaces ensures a high quality of life for its residents.
